It would appear so for a later date on delivery from a complete production run. Production factory's build to a schedule,design changes,improvements, part availability all affect this process. There is also safety and communication regulations for each country to pass. Plus they are reliant on thier software house Liztic to match hardware changes and have a working product. Don't forget Android is now Marshmallow and needs to be customised.

Don't forget integration with the PHA and docking module via firmware.

Hopefully the Cyberdrive team will learn from the feedback for any future projects regarding keeping backers updated. I'm on the Echobox DAP indiegogo as well, which was originally due to be delivered around the end of March like the Pro X. The Echobox guys let everyone know a few months back that it was likely to be pushed back to a May delivery by the time they got the product the way they wanted it, and no one batted an eyelid. The CD team kept pushing "end of March" right up until this week, and people have been ready to burn the internet down.
